Bigweld is the founder of Bigweld Industries, a company devoted to creating the lives of robots far better in the motion picture Robots. Voiced by the famous Mel Brooks, Bigweld is a major character in the animated film, recognised for his inspiring catchphrases and his unwavering perception in the prospective of every robot.
In the world of Robots, Bigweld is portrayed as a big, shiny robot with brown eyes. His bodily look incorporates a spherical, spherical physique with a little head on top rated and two massive arms. He is frequently witnessed sporting a steel, tuxedo-like covering that conceals the higher half of his physique, although his reduced 50 percent lacks legs, letting him to go around by rolling.
Bigweld’s character is defined by his optimistic and encouraging character. As the head of Bigweld Industries, he is acknowledged for his two catchphrases: “See a need, fill a need to have” and “You can shine, no make any difference what you’re built of.” He firmly thinks that any robotic can occur up with modern concepts and keeps his factory doorways open for aspiring younger inventors, such as Rodney Copperbottom, who idolizes him. Bigweld also hosts a tv display, “The Bigweld Show,” exactly where he offers insights into the inventing system and encourages robots to feel in by themselves.

The Rise and Fall of Bigweld
Bigweld’s journey will take a sizeable change when Ratchet normally takes in excess of Bigweld Industries, primary to a decrease in the enterprise’s values and the discontinuation of spare areas generation. This shift in leadership renders Bigweld an outmode, creating him to retreat into seclusion in his mansion, the place he spends his time setting up and knocking down dominoes, adopting the persona of a cranky outdated hermit.
In spite of his first reluctance, Bigweld’s fighting spirit is reignited when Rodney and Cappy seek out him out. He in the long run joins forces with them and The Rusties to beat Ratchet’s malevolent programs. This pivotal moment marks Bigweld’s resurgence as a chief and innovator, as he performs a important position in overthrowing Ratchet and restoring Bigweld Industries to its previous glory. His gratitude in direction of Rodney is evident as he not only materials spare sections to Rodney’s father but also designates Rodney as his eventual successor at Bigweld Industries.
Powering the Scenes and Trivia
Right before Mel Brooks was forged as the voice of Bigweld, numerous noteworthy actors, which include Kelsey Grammer, Ned Beatty, Robert De Niro, and Bill Nighy, ended up regarded for the part. This marked Brooks’ initial foray into voice performing for a theatrically produced film, paving the way for his subsequent voice roles in animated movies this sort of as Mr. Peabody & Sherman, the Hotel Transylvania collection, and Toy Tale 4.
